What rod do you use for to throw a punker? I have tried a couple of mine but I can't seem to get the right feel. I'm throwing the 6" punker. Thanks
Re: Punker Question????
For the 6" Punker I Love the Dobyns 735c. Big enough to handle any bass and small enough to make accurate cast. For the bigger Punkers I up size to the 797SBMT. Awesome rod for the big stuff.

Re: Punker Question????
Steve Beichman's 7'6" Swimbait Special SCR-751 EX-Fast tip! Great control for casting and slow dig and glide retrieve I use with the 6" Wooden Punkers.
When I'm tossing the lighter injected Punkers, I switch up to one of my Fenwick Elite-Tech ECSWB79H-F. This is a lil longer rod at 7'9", much lighter overall and has a very good tip action for the faster dog walking retrieve I use with the plastick Punkers.
